Watling, R., 1982
Bolbitiaceae: Agrocybe, Bolbitius & Conocybe
This group is Roy's specialism.
Keys to genera and then generic keys to species, followed by lengthy species accounts. The Ecological List of Species groups them by habitat.
Some of the line drawings are a bit small and/or crowded.
Some of the Agrocybe species recognised here are now known to interbreed, and have been synonymised in more recent works (eg the UK checklist).

| Comments and Corrigenda |
Key to species, couplet 57, 2nd alternative "pale buff, tinged salmon clay-pink" Key to species, couplet 58, 2nd alternative should be "(G)" not "(B)" |
| Coverage |
All the British species known at the time. |
| Illustrations |
Line drawings at the back. |
| Identify |
Under a Compound Microscope. |
| Specimen Prep. |
Microscopy of cystidia and spores. |
| Difficulty |
Agrocybe needs care, but Conocybe has good microscopic characters and is relatively straightforward. |
